Picking the Right Design and Layout
When you're producing a funeral pamphlet, picking the right style and format is vital, as it shows the personality of the deceased and the tone of the service.
Begin by considering the deceased's rate of interests and enthusiasms; these aspects can guide your design choices. For instance, if they loved nature, a floral style might be suitable.
Next off, decide on the booklet dimension-- regular alternatives include typical letter dimension or a smaller, extra mobile layout.
Take notice of typography; choose typefaces that are both understandable and appropriate for the event.
Finally, think of pictures and colors; they need to evoke the right feelings while maintaining a respectful tone.
Crucial Element to Include in the Funeral Brochure
While crafting a funeral booklet, it's vital to consist of key elements that honor the dead and give comfort to attendees.
Start with the individual's full name, date of birth, and day of passing, making sure everyone recognizes that you're commemorating. A quick bio highlights their life trip and success, providing context to their legacy.

Customizing the Tribute: Stories and Memories
To truly honor the deceased and make the funeral brochure reverberate with participants, personal tales and cherished memories play a vital function.
Think about the minutes that display their character and spirit. Did they have a preferred hobby, an amusing trait, or a life-changing experience? Invite family and friends to share their very own stories, too. This not only produces a richer homage yet additionally fosters link amongst attendees.
Integrate these tales into the pamphlet, possibly under headings like "Favorite Memories" or "Stories to keep in mind." Including pictures that enhance these memories can enhance the emotional influence.
